Diamondback Fitness Unveils All-New Product Line for 20th Anniversary

 

 

Heading into 2011 Diamondback Fitness has heavily invested in product development and evolved its brand, bucking the trend in an industry that is widely pulling back on the development side. The new completely redesigned product line of ellipticals, recumbent and upright fitness bikes is the culmination of a three-year plan that involved moving Diamondback Fitness from Southern California to Seattle, cross-pollinating on a design level with the Diamondback bicycle division and focusing its sales strategy on the specialty market.
 
Product design is a primary differentiator for the brand that released its first fitness products in 1991. The new value-oriented collection is highly featured and takes its cues from the bicycle industry with attention to detail rarely experienced in fitness equipment, including custom saddles, anodized quick release levers and high-performance bearings and crank sets.
 
A notable first in the industry is the addition of Apple® product docking stations in the high-end 910Sr Recumbent ($899), the 910Er Elliptical ($1,699) and the 910Ub Upright ($799). The iPod, iPhone and iPad dock simultaneously charges the unit and holds it in place for easy access to entertainment and training applications during workouts.
 
Diamondback Fitness further expanded its collection with the introduction of the 910Ic that firmly establishes a new category of indoor cycles. The innovative model features exclusive computer-controlled-resistance that emulates riding on hills and offers target heart-rate training options to deliver a more effective, real-world workout. Additionally, the new technology is self -powered allowing training sessions to be enjoyed anywhere indoors or outdoors without power cords.
 
All of the brand’s new uprights, recumbents, ellipticals and indoor cycles will be unveiled at the 2011 Health + Fitness Business Expo in Las Vegas, September 22-23 at booth #713. I am a gym rat. I am used to doing cardio at my gym. They have uprights, recumbent, treadmills and ellipticals. In short I am used to doing cardio on exercise machines that cost more than some new and some used cars.

 

I was not a fan of recumbent bikes, but after a few days of use, it is comfortable, easy to use and gets you a great sweet. Best of all it is easier on the knee joints.

 

As far as assembly- it is easy and took about an hour. They provide all the tools you need to put it together. In all, you are basically attaching the seat, pedals, the two stabilizing bars (front and back) on the base and attaching the console and console bar to the unit.

 

As I said before I am a gym rat and am used to working out on high end equipment. That being said, this is a great machine. It is easy to use and links up to my polar heart rate. There is plenty of resistance to keep you challenged and most importantly it runs quietly. So quite, that you are more likely to make more noise from your shorts rubbing together than using the bike.

Founded in 1991 as an off-shoot of the legendary bicycle brand, Diamondback Fitness was as a natural evolution... an evolution from classic outdoor bicycle usage, toward indoor-based cycling and cross training. Fitness enthusiasts were searching for ways to maintain fitness during times of inclement weather that were similar to there Diamondback outdoor cycling experiences or were simply looking for new and different cross-training options . Eighteen years later, Diamondback Fitness continues to lead the industry in "high quality, featured loaded, value priced" exercise equipment as the strong Diamondback brand resonates with both the “boomers” who grew up with the bicycles, as well as the younger generations riding them today.

 

Diamondback Fitness continues to build upon this legendary brand identity by offering the cardio enthusiast a full line of upright bicycles, recumbents, and elliptical trainers that offer great value and extremely high quality in an intuitive & visually pleasing package.
